随着互联网技术的发展,越来越多的企业和个人选择将业务迁移到云端。云主机作为云计算服务中的一种,具有灵活性高、成本低等优点,成为了很多用户的首选。本文将从零开始带你了解如何在阿里云上搭建自己的云主机服务器。
一、什么是云主机?
云主机是一种基于互联网的计算方式,通过网络连接为用户提供可伸缩性强、管理方便的计算资源服务。用户可以根据实际需求随时调整资源配置,而无需关心底层硬件设施的具体情况。
二、选择合适的云服务提供商
目前市面上提供云服务的公司很多,但并非所有平台都能满足你的具体需求。建议优先考虑那些拥有良好口碑和技术实力的服务商,比如阿里巴巴旗下的阿里云就非常受欢迎。它不仅提供了丰富的产品线,还经常推出各种优惠政策帮助中小企业降低成本。
三、注册账号并完成实名认证
如果你还没有阿里云账号的话,首先需要访问官网进行注册,并按照指引完成手机号码验证及身份证信息上传等步骤来实现个人或企业的实名制认证。这一步骤对于保证账户安全非常重要。
四、选购适合的ECS实例
Elastic Compute Service (ECS) 是阿里云提供的弹性计算服务之一,支持按需购买和配置虚拟机实例。根据你打算运行的应用程序类型以及预计的流量规模等因素,合理选择CPU核数、内存大小、磁盘容量等参数。同时还可以考虑是否开启自动备份功能以增强数据安全性。
五、设置网络安全规则
为了防止未经授权的访问,你需要为新创建的ECS实例配置防火墙策略。通常情况下,我们会开放80端口允许HTTP请求进入;如果网站使用了HTTPS协议,则还需要额外开放443端口。除此之外,建议关闭不必要的服务端口以减少潜在风险。
六、安装操作系统与软件环境
大多数情况下,阿里云会提供预装好常用操作系统的镜像供用户选择。选定后即可快速启动系统。接下来根据项目要求安装相应的Web服务器(如Apache或Nginx)、数据库管理系统(如MySQL)以及其他必要的工具软件。
七、部署应用程序代码
当基础环境准备完毕后,就可以把开发好的应用程序部署到云服务器上了。如果是静态站点可以直接上传HTML文件;而对于动态网页则需要将源代码放在指定目录并通过命令行执行相关操作完成部署流程。
八、测试与优化
在正式上线前务必对整个系统进行全面检查,确保各项功能正常运作。此外还可以利用阿里云提供的监控工具定期查看服务器性能状态,及时发现并解决问题。
以上就是关于如何在阿里云平台上搭建云主机服务器的全部内容。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/258330.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。